The posting rule (or mailbox rule in the United States, also known as the " postal rule " or " deposited acceptance rule ") is an exception to the general rule of contract law in common law countries that acceptance of an offer takes place when communicated. Contract law. Offer and acceptance are generally recognized as essential requirements for the formation of a contract (together with other requirements such as consideration and legal capacity ). Invitation Homes Inc. is a public company traded on the New York Stock Exchange. It is headquartered in the Lincoln Center in Dallas, Texas. [ 2] Dallas B. Tanner is chief executive officer. Wood's dispatch is the informal name for a formal dispatch that was sent by Sir Charles Wood, the President of the Board of Control of the British East India Company to Lord Dalhousie, the Governor-General of India. RSVP is an initialism derived from the French phrase "Répondez s'il vous plaît", [ 1] meaning "Please respond" (literally "Respond, if it pleases you" ), to require confirmation of an invitation.
